Transaction e87a21af264486609e863bfce06c98499febd826a975dc9a0fa09d6bbbf7c8a5
1 Input
1 Output
-
e87a21af264486609e863bfce06c98499febd826a975dc9a0fa09d6bbbf7c8a5:0
- value
- 505400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d979649bd8e0492d20187e34d4cc8a4e66976a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DufsW7EBv5smFCpFERn4YbCvB1pUvawgo